Uses of Class
org.apache.calcite.adapter.druid.DruidQuery.JsonAggregation
-
Packages that use DruidQuery.JsonAggregation Package Description org.apache.calcite.adapter.druid Query provider based on a Druid database. -
-
Uses of DruidQuery.JsonAggregation in org.apache.calcite.adapter.druid
Subclasses of DruidQuery.JsonAggregation in org.apache.calcite.adapter.druid Modifier and Type Class Description private static class
DruidQuery.JsonCardinalityAggregation
Aggregation element that calls the "cardinality" function.private static class
DruidQuery.JsonFilteredAggregation
Aggregation element that contains a filterFields in org.apache.calcite.adapter.druid declared as DruidQuery.JsonAggregation Modifier and Type Field Description (package private) DruidQuery.JsonAggregation
DruidQuery.JsonFilteredAggregation. aggregation
Methods in org.apache.calcite.adapter.druid that return DruidQuery.JsonAggregation Modifier and Type Method Description private static DruidQuery.JsonAggregation
DruidQuery. getJsonAggregation(java.lang.String name, AggregateCall aggCall, RexNode filterNode, java.lang.String fieldName, java.lang.String aggExpression, DruidQuery druidQuery)
Methods in org.apache.calcite.adapter.druid that return types with arguments of type DruidQuery.JsonAggregation Modifier and Type Method Description protected static java.util.List<DruidQuery.JsonAggregation>
DruidQuery. computeDruidJsonAgg(java.util.List<AggregateCall> aggCalls, java.util.List<java.lang.String> aggNames, Project project, DruidQuery druidQuery)
Translates aggregate calls to DruidDruidQuery.JsonAggregation
s when possible.Constructors in org.apache.calcite.adapter.druid with parameters of type DruidQuery.JsonAggregation Constructor Description JsonFilteredAggregation(DruidJsonFilter filter, DruidQuery.JsonAggregation aggregation)
-